The Challenge: Premium Design Meets Uncompromising Performance

The 3C (Computer, Communication, and Consumer Electronics) Industry demands materials that can deliver a perfect balance of aesthetic appeal, structural integrity, and lightweight design. Devices like laptops, mobile phones, and electronic communication equipment require components that are:

  • Lightweight and High-Strength: To enable slim, portable designs without sacrificing durability.

  • Corrosion Resistant: To withstand daily wear, sweat, and environmental exposure.

  • Non-Magnetic: Essential for sensitive electronic components and wireless charging.

  • Premium Metallic Texture: To provide a high-end, tactile finish that elevates brand perception.

Titanium, with its superior low specific gravity, high strength, corrosion resistance, and inherent non-magnetic properties, is the ultimate material solution for next-generation consumer electronics.

Key Application Sectors

Our high-precision titanium products are engineered for the following critical components in the 3C sector:

  • Folding Screens: Used in hinge mechanisms and structural supports where high strength-to-weight ratio and fatigue resistance are crucial for long-term reliability.

  • Titanium Fasteners: Miniature screws and bolts for internal assembly, offering superior strength and reduced weight compared to steel.

  • Casings and Bezels: External frames and shells for mobile phones and laptops, providing exceptional durability and a premium, scratch-resistant metallic finish.

Applicable Material Standards and Grades

The primary titanium mill products used in the 3C industry adhere to the following standards, with a focus on higher-strength Commercially Pure (CP) grades and alloys:

Titanium Product FormApplicable ASTM StandardDescriptionApplicable Grades
Titanium Strip, Sheet, and FoilASTM B265-06aTitanium and Titanium Alloy Strip, Sheet, and Plate (Thin Gauge)Gr3, Gr4, Gr5

Focus on Key Grades: Strength, Non-Magnetism, and Finish

  • Grade 3 (Gr3): A higher-strength CP grade, offering superior mechanical properties over Gr1 and Gr2 while retaining excellent corrosion resistance and non-magnetic characteristics. Ideal for structural components.

  • Grade 4 (Gr4): The highest strength CP grade, used when maximum strength and hardness are required for thin-walled components and fasteners, maintaining its non-magnetic nature.

  • Grade 5 (Gr5) / Ti-6Al-4V: The alpha-beta alloy, providing the highest strength and is often used for critical fasteners and hinge components where maximum durability is needed.

Case Study 1: Ultra-Lightweight Laptop Casings

Industry: Premium Laptop Manufacturing

Challenge: Designing a large-format laptop that is significantly lighter than competitors while maintaining superior rigidity and a high-end feel.

Titanium Solution: Utilization of Grade 4 Titanium Sheet (ASTM B265) for the top and bottom casings. The high strength-to-weight ratio allowed for thinner material gauges, achieving the weight target without compromising structural integrity.

Outcome: A laptop that is 20% lighter than the previous generation, featuring a durable, scratch-resistant, and premium metallic finish that significantly enhanced the product's market position.

Case Study 2: High-Durability Folding Phone Hinges

Industry: Folding Mobile Phones

Challenge: Developing a hinge mechanism that is extremely thin, highly durable against repeated folding cycles, and non-magnetic to avoid interference with internal electronics.

Titanium Solution: Precision-machined components and fasteners made from Grade 5 (Ti-6Al-4V) and Grade 3 Titanium Strip. The material's excellent fatigue strength and non-magnetic property were critical to the hinge's performance and the phone's overall functionality.

Outcome: A hinge mechanism certified for hundreds of thousands of folds, providing a reliable, lightweight, and non-interfering solution for the complex folding screen technology.
